The Ultimate Guide to Checking Your Browsing History in Vista

To check browsing history in Windows Vista, one must open Internet Explorer and select the “Tools” menu. From the drop-down menu, choose “History” and then “View History.” This will open a new window displaying a list of all websites visited within a specified date range. One can also click on the “Address Bar” and select “View History” to access previously visited websites.

Being able to check browsing history can be useful for various reasons, such as retracing steps taken while researching a topic or revisiting websites of interest. Moreover, it is essential for troubleshooting issues related to website accessibility and performance.

How to Check CPU Usage in Unix: A Quick and Comprehensive Guide

Monitoring CPU usage is crucial for optimizing system performance and ensuring smooth operation. In Unix-based systems, there are several commands that provide detailed information about CPU utilization.

The ‘top’ command is a widely used tool that displays real-time information about the system’s overall CPU usage, as well as the processes that are consuming the most resources. It provides a constantly updating view of the system’s performance, making it easy to identify any potential issues.

5 Easy Ways to Check Your User Agent (Practical Tips)

A user agent is a software application that makes HTTP requests to a web server on behalf of a user. It can be a web browser, a mobile app, or even a command-line tool. When a user agent makes a request, it sends along a string of information that identifies the user agent and its capabilities. This information is known as the user agent string.

The user agent string can be used to track a user’s browsing history, identify their device, and target them with advertising. However, it can also be used to protect users from malicious websites and to improve the performance of web pages.
